Repair-Engineer-small.pngHow to Do a Door Lock Change

Change of the door lock is a quick and cheap way to improve your home security. However, this process is not for everyone. It requires a certain amount patience and skill.

You need to replace the cylinder that is within the knob's body. The cylinder recognizes the key when it is put into the lock.

Removing the old lock

First, you must remove the lock that was previously in place. This is a relatively simple procedure, but there are a few things to remember. First, make sure that the lock you choose to install is the right size for your door. This will ensure that it fits securely and doesn't leave a gap in the latch or deadbolt plug.

After you've removed the latch plate look for two screws or bolts on the inside of the casing that connect the casing and halves of the lock. Unscrew these with a screwdriver and then take the lock out of the door. If you are using a mortise locking system, there is a set screw that holds the handle to the spindle. Use a screwdriver to unscrew the screw, and then take out the doorknobs.

Take the deadbolt and latch plug from your door jamb. Install the new lock. If you're replacing a mortise you should determine the distance between the lock case and your door's edge to ensure that the new lock will fit.

Selecting a new locking system

There are many options to choose from when it comes to selecting a new lock. Think about the various kinds of window locks repair near me and select one that fits the style of your door. Take into consideration the backset which is the distance between the edge and the center of the hole for the lock. Also, consider the cross bore, which is a small hole in the middle of your door's frame. Also, ensure that you select a lock that is able to be able to fit the door's thickness and swing.

The American National Standards Institute and BHMA have graded most window locks repair for doors to give you an idea of their durability and how difficult it is to pick them or disable them. A grade 3 lock may be ideal for a peaceful apartment in the countryside, whereas locks that are grade 1 could be more appropriate for an area with a lot of traffic, such as an open-air storefront.

Installing a new lock

If you're replacing a previous lock, start by measuring the width of your door. The majority of residential locksets are designed for doors with a thickness of 1 3/8 to 3/4 inches. If your door is thicker it will require a door kit that is thick and includes longer screws, an extended tail piece (for door knobs) or spindle extension (for deadbolts).

Most locks come with a detailed instruction manual to help you install the new hardware. Take the time to read the instructions prior to beginning the process to make sure that you are following all the steps. The booklet will give you a good idea of how much skill is required to finish the task.
